Strengths:
cheap compared to e.13 and MRP
Quite strong
attaches to my iscg mounts
Weaknesses:
Had to bore away at my bb shell to get it on
Similar Products Used:
fuse device on specialized p2
Bike Setup:
Specialized p.All Mountain
Bottom Line:
good strong device that keeps your chain on most of the time and is quiet once set up correctly.
